What is Micro Current Neurofeedback?

IASIS MCN (micro current neurofeedback) is a non-invasive, non-medicinal, and revolutionary type of neurotechnology that helps optimize brain performance. IASIS MCN does not train the brain like traditional neurofeedback; rather it “retrains” the brain and CNS (central nervous system) by allowing it to reorganize itself and shift from its formerly fixed patterns. This is analogous to re-booting a “frozen” computer. And similar to a computer reboot, IASIS helps a person’s brain activity restart and rebalance very gently. This process is repeated over the course of several sessions, eventually resulting in the brain becoming permanently calibrated and stabilized. IASIS is the very first neurofeedback system backed by image-based evidence of success.

What does IASIS MCN treatment look like?

IASIS treatment sessions will be administered in a relaxing environment. Some non-greasy electrode paste will be gently applied to the skin on certain sites of the head and neck, to help improve the conductive quality of the recording. Several electrodes (similar to EKG leads but much smaller) will then be placed embedded into the paste. After a short assessment of the equipment and the by the clinician, the equipment itself then generates extremely faint, battery-generated signals. These low-intensity pulses of energy encourage the brain to respond in beneficial ways and help support the central nervous system. As a reference point for intensity level, a cellular telephone generates a signal at least 10 million times the power of the IASIS MCN signal. The intensity of MCN is less than a trillionth of a watt and will only take place for a few seconds at a time during each procedure, which is why no instances of problems with the emissions have ever been recorded. During the session you will be asked to relax and sit quietly. You will be asked to try not to think or focus on anything in particular; no imagery, no constructive thoughts, and especially nothing stressful, as we’ve found that this can slow treatment progress. Your brain will be able to detect the feedback, although you will not see or feel anything.

In the time period between treatments, in order to help us best tailor the program to fit your situation, you will be asked to observe and keep track of symptom improvements, discomforts, or any other changes that you may notice.

Is treatment a one-time deal, or will return visits be required?

Because the healing effects of IASIS are cumulative, we highly recommend investing in one of our package programs (see clinician for pricing). Commitment to an ongoing, interactive level of care allows our clinicians ample time to measure reactivity and improvement between treatments and to adjust treatment protocols accordingly. Each IASIS MCN session adds to the positive impact of the last, creating a cumulative healing process and moving the brain and central nervous system towards peak functioning.

How many treatment sessions will be needed?

The average number of treatments required for optimal success is between 10-25 sessions. This can be difficult to predict, due to each individual having a unique set of circumstances. Some determinant factors include age, duration and severity of symptoms, and overall lifestyle habits. For example, if your problem came on suddenly, after a life of high-functioning activity, you may only need a minimal number of sessions. However, if you have a lifelong history of multiple chronic problems, a more substantial investment may be required. Your initial consultation will help with setting the proper expectations up front.

When will it be time to discontinue IASIS treatment?

It will be time to discontinue treatment when you stabilize and achieve consistently improved functioning in your daily life. Most of those who have received IASIS treatment have continued to realize improvement long after IASIS has ended.

IASIS does not treat symptoms, rather it focuses on addressing the actual source of the symptoms. Various studies of the brain have shown people who suffer from anxiety, post-traumatic stress, depression, and other conditions have high levels of abnormal delta wave activity. Therefore, the IASIS MCN system isolates its focus to the areas in the brain which are exhibiting those abnormal delta waves.

The Research Behind the Technology

  • The Department of Radiology at the University of California at San Diego (UCSD) and the US Department of Veterans Affairs piloted studies of IASIS Micro Current Neurofeedback in 2017. The pilot study utilized working with U.S. Marines from Camp Pendleton who were returning from the Middle East with post-traumatic stress (PTS) and traumatic brain injury (TBI). They took magnet encephalography images before and after treatments to demonstrate the effect of this method on brain abnormalities in patients with traumatic brain injury. They saw a 54 percent (54%) reduction in abnormalities and a 53 percent (53) reduction in symptoms. Patients recorded improvements in headache, sleep disorders, anxiety disorders, stuttering, hypersensitivity, tobacco consumption, memory, focus and concentration, and frustration resilience.
  • The University of Texas has had such incredible success with IASIS Technology in mitigating common Behavioral Health problems like anxiety and depression that their research department at the UT Tyler branch has now started two formal research studies on the effectiveness of IASIS. The studies are focused on mitigating anxiety and depression and slowing down the progression of Alzheimer’s disease. Additionally, a new double-blinded and randomized research study is now being co-authored by UT Tyler with Matthews Hope Foundation to determine the effectiveness of IASIS in promoting abstinence-based sobriety without relapse in active opioid users.
